ONE NATION UNDER WHAT? UNDER WHO?
NBC's opening of the U.S. Open Golf Championship yesterday (6/21/2011) included two readings of the Pledge of Allegiance, but omitted the phrase "under God" both times. The program started with children standing in a classroom, as they recited the "edited" version of the Pledge of allegiance, which omitted the words "under God".
